/**
* 208. Implement Trie (Prefix Tree)
*
* Implement a trie with insert, search, and startsWith methods.
*
* Note:
* You may assume that all inputs are consist of lowercase letters a-z.
*/
/**
* For Recursive version of the Trie implementation, see
* https://github.com/fluency03/leetcode-java/blob/master/src/ImplementTriePrefixTree208.java
*/
public class Trie {
private TrieNode root;
/** Initialize your data structure here. */
public Trie() {
root = new TrieNode();
}
/** Inserts a word into the trie. */
public void insert(String word) {
TrieNode node = root;
for (int i = 0; i < word.length(); i++) {
char c = word.charAt(i);
if (!node.containsKey(c)) {
node.put(c, new TrieNode());
}
node = node.get(c);
}
node.setLeaf();
}
/** Returns if the word is in the trie. */
public boolean search(String word) {
TrieNode node = root;
for (int i = 0; i < word.length(); i++) {
char c = word.charAt(i);
if (!node.containsKey(c)) {
return false;
}
node = node.get(c);
}
return node.isLeaf();
}
/** Returns if there is any word in the trie that starts with the given prefix. */
public boolean startsWith(String prefix) {
TrieNode node = root;
for (int i = 0; i < prefix.length(); i++) {
char c = prefix.charAt(i);
if (!node.containsKey(c)) {
return false;
}
node = node.get(c);
}
return true;
}
}
/**
* Your Trie object will be instantiated and called as such:
* Trie obj = new Trie();
* obj.insert(word);
* boolean param_2 = obj.search(word);
* boolean param_3 = obj.startsWith(prefix);
*/
